I need some info in relation to DCC and NS E-Z track also.
I have a 5 meter x 2.5 meter double track oval with several siding in the middle and a total
of 6 DCC turnouts.
A lot of this track is 1 meter straights.
I'm using the standard E-Z Command Dynamis system with one feeder.
Everything runs fine but I'd like to add at least on more feeder.
I can't find anything made by Bachmann that has a central junction from the Command Station
to allow multiple feeders to run from it.
Basically I want a double adapter type accessory that connects to the Command Station.

Any help would be appreciated.
